Cryptocurrency performance has become a focal point of discussion for investors, particularly due to its pronounced volatility. Unlike traditional assets, the unpredictable nature of digital currencies raises critical questions about risk-adjusted returns and overall investment trends. The Bloomberg Galaxy Crypto Index, created to track the performance of leading cryptocurrencies, highlights stark differences in growth rates, showcasing a near 90% increase since late 2017. However, this impressive figure comes with a caveat: the volatility of cryptocurrencies can be up to seven times greater than that experienced in global equity markets. As a result, comprehensive cryptocurrency analysis is essential for making informed investment decisions in this dynamic landscape.

| Key Point | Details |
|---|---|
| Analyst Insight | Mike McGlone suggests cryptocurrencies are underperforming in comparison to global stocks. |
| Risk Adjustment | When adjusted for risk, cryptocurrencies exhibit inferior performance relative to stocks. |
| Current Market Trends | The rapid increase in risk asset valuations might be nearing an end. |
| Historical Performance | From late 2017 to December 30, the Bloomberg Galaxy Crypto Index rose approximately 90%. |
| Volatility Comparison | Annual cryptocurrency volatility is roughly seven times greater than that of the global stock market. |
